I get to choose what I want to work on, outside of my initial responsibilities of triaging bugs.
I currently manage a handful of features on my team that continue growing.
Sometimes the influx of bugs can be high, and I get less time to dedicate my full focus on my additional responsibilities.
My manager is amazing. He makes sure we get the projects finished, is decisive, and trusts my teammates and me.
The interview process had two rounds, primarily focused on my previous projects. The interviewer explored similarities between my past responsibilities and the expectations for the current role at Apple specifically.
The interview sequence began with a conversation with the hiring manager, followed by a coding exercise, a system design session, and several peer interviews. These interviews explored areas such as: * Team management * Cross-functional collaboratio
Had a very long system design interview today. It included many MVVM-related questions, required me to explain architecture patterns clearly, and I had to draw a detailed, accurate flowchart diagram.
The interview process had two rounds, primarily focused on my previous projects. The interviewer explored similarities between my past responsibilities and the expectations for the current role at Apple specifically.
The interview sequence began with a conversation with the hiring manager, followed by a coding exercise, a system design session, and several peer interviews. These interviews explored areas such as: * Team management * Cross-functional collaboratio
Had a very long system design interview today. It included many MVVM-related questions, required me to explain architecture patterns clearly, and I had to draw a detailed, accurate flowchart diagram.